Honors and Awards: 2017 Big Ten Defensive Player of the Year ... Only the third player in conference history to win the award more than once ... ... 2017 All-Big Ten Defensive Team (unanimous selection) ... 2017 Second Team All-Big Ten ... Finalist for the 2017 Nancy Lieberman Award, given to the nation's top point guard ... 2016 B1G Defensive Player of the Year... 2016 B1G All-Defensive Team... 2016 Honorable Mention All-B1G (Media)... 2016 Academic All-B1G... 2015 Honorable Mention All-B1G (Media and Coaches)... 2014 Honorable Mention All-Big Ten (Media) ... Finalist for 2014 Nancy Lieberman Award, which honors the nation's top point guard.

2016-17: Finished season with 191 steals to lead the Big Ten and career with 429 ... Set Big Ten all-time steals record against Ohio State (1/3) with 373rd career takeaway … NU’s all-time steals leader … Second in career assists (788) … Became third active Wildcat to score 1,000 career points against Oral Roberts (11/13) … 3.8 steals per game ranks second nationally … Has recorded multiple steals in all but three games this year.
B1G: Leads the Big Ten in assists per game (6.4) and steals per game (3.8) … Seventh in assist/turnover ratio (2.1) … Scored a season-high 20 points with seven assists and four steals against Michigan State (1/17) … Dished out 14 assists against Ohio State (1/3) … Scored 18 points on 6-of-12 shooting with eight assists against Indiana (1/14) … One of 20 point guards named to the Lieberman Watch List at the beginning of the year.

High School: Four-year varsity letterwinner ... Flower Mound High School's all-time leading scorer ... 2013 McDonald's All-American nominee ... 2013 Texas Girls Coaches' Association (TGCA) First-Team All-State honoree ... Texas Association of Basketball Coaches (TABC) All-Region honoree in 2013 ... 2013 DFW All-Area Team ... 2013 All-VYPE North Texas First Team and First Team All-Denton County ... 2013 District T-TA (5-5A) Scoring Champ (16.1 ppg) and led the district in assists and steals per game ... 2013 All-District 5-5A Team and MVP ... Flower Mound captured the 2013 District 5-5A Championship and Bi-District Championship ... Averaged 18 points, four assists, five steals and four rebounds per game as a junior ... All-Tournament honoree at the Frisco Tournament and Flower Mound Tournament where she also earned MVP honors in 2013 ... Ranked 15th best player in the state of Texas and top-20 point guard in the nation by Texas Basketball Report ... 2012 District 8-5A Offensive Player of the Year ... District 8-5A First Team All-District as a sophomore and junior ... 2012 First Team All-Vype (All-North Texas) ... 2012 TABC All-Region Team (Region 1-5A) ... 2012 All-Tournament honoree at Flower Mound Tournament ... Team MVP as a junior and senior ... Two-time team captain ... Named team Defensive Player of the Year as a freshman and sophomore ... Varsity starter as a freshman ... Participated in the Nike Skills Academy in May 2012 ... Had two 30-point outbursts as a junior and senior ... School record for most points in a game, career and season, steals in a game, career and season and most assists in a game, career and season ... Registered a triple-double of 30 points, 10 assists and 12 steals in January, 2012 ... Played AAU for Westside Elite (2009-10) a Cyfair Mickens (2011-12) ... AAU teams won multiple tournaments, including 2011 Nike U-15 Nationals ... Three-time Academic All-District ... Four-year honor roll ... Graduated with honors and received the Distinguished Academic Student award ... Member of the National Honor Society ... Recipient of AP Scholar Award her junior year ... Played against fellow NU signee Christen Inman and current Wildcat Maggie Lyon ... Also ran varsity track as a freshman.

Personal: Born Ashley Nicole Deary ... Daughter of Kim and Vaughn Deary ... Father, Vaughn, played running back and wide receiver for Texas State and was an all-conference wide receiver as a senior ... Has an older sister, Vanessa, and younger brother, Sterling ... Major is Economics with a minor in Business Institutions.
